    Co-Op Travel Charity Assault Course

    Thursday, April 30th, 2009

    On Sunday 19th April, over 45 travel advisors and almost twice as many spectators from The Co-operative Travel Centre in Arnold took part in The Adrenalin Jungles Assault Course Challenge. The event was held to raise funds for the RNID – the charity for people who are deaf or hard of hearing.
    Staff from Arnold, Coventry, Long Eaton, Hinkley, Mansfield, Bulwell and Cradley Heath Branches to name a few successfully completed our gruelling hour long course and raised £2,500 for the charity.
    With the support of its members and customers, The Co-operative hope to continue to raise more than £2million for the charity.

    Smooth FM go Army Barmy at The Jungle on their Birthday

    Wednesday, April 8th, 2009

    The National Sales Team for Smooth FM chose The Adrenalin Jungle to host their 2nd birthday team event last month. As you can see from the photos they were all smooth operators. They spent 4 hours in our themed army bunker meeting room being drilled in the art of advertising sales, before heading out to a triple event challenge of The Jungle Assault Course, Laser Tag and Blindfold 4×4 Driver Competition.
